HC Deb 21 February 1968 vol 759 cc114-5W
58. Mr. Longden

asked the Minister of Transport what progress she has made in her plans to introduce new regulations for controlling exhaust fumes from motor vehicles.

Mr. Carmichael

We have no such plans. It is already unlawful for a vehicle to discharge excessive smoke or vapour and medical research has not so far shown a need to control these emissions more closely.
